No. 1 Eagles Suffer Double Overtime Heartbreaker in Semifinal to UMass Lowell
March 17, 2021 | Men's Hockey
CHESTNUT HILL, Mass. – Matt Brown batted a puck out of the air inside the left post with eight minutes left in double overtime, lifting No. 7 seed UMass Lowell past top seed Boston College by a 6-5 final in the Hockey East Semifinal on Wednesday night at Kelley Rink.

The Eagles thought they had won the game in the first overtime when Patrick Giles deflected a right point shot from Jack St. Ivany, but the potential game-winner was overturned after video review revealed that BC was offside prior to the goal.
Â
Boston College will enter the NCAA Tournament with a 17-5-1 record heading into the Selection Show on Sunday night. UMass Lowell improved to 10-8-1 and will visit No. 3 seed UMass on Saturday for the Hockey East Championship Game.
Â
The Eagles were led by their sophomore class, which combined for 12 points on the night. The top line of Alex Newhook (2-3-5), Matt Boldy (0-4-4) and Mike Hardman (1-1-2) all had multi-point performances, while Marshall Warren netted his third goal of the year.
Â
The River Hawks stormed back from 4-1 down in the third period, but captain Marc McLaughlin restored the lead at 5-4 on the power play with 2:07 remaining in regulation. Lowell answered 40 seconds later on a deflected point shot just as goaltender Henry Welsch reached the bench for an extra skater.
Â
Spencer Knight made a season-high 43 saves but suffered just his third defeat of the season. BC was 5-for-6 on the penalty kill and blocked 19 shots.
Â
SCORING SUMMARY
1st 7:34, BC (1-0) | Newhook dropped the puck along the right wing for Boldy, who cut to the top of the faceoff circle before fluttering a backhand pass to the back door for Warren to finish top shelf.
Â
2nd 6:44, BC (2-0) | During a 3-on-0 with its top line on the ice, Newhook fed Boldy on the left wing and the sophomore settled the puck before dropping to Hardman for a glove side one-timer from the low slot.
Â
2nd 12:40, BC (3-0) | St. Ivany's right point shot trickled wide but Hardman spun the puck back into the slot for an open Newhook, who fired a shot into the top corner glove side.
Â
2nd 13:01, UML (3-1) | Anthony Baxter gloved the puck down at neutral ice and gained the BC blue line before ripping a shot blocker side from the high slot.
Â
2nd 18:47, BC (4-1) | From the left wing half boards, Boldy centered a pass to Newhook in the slot and the forward delayed before picking out the bottom left corner off the post.
Â
3rd 10:25, UML (4-2) | Reid Stefanson reeled in a pass from Brown in the high slot and sent a snap shot over the blocker of Knight into the top left corner.
Â
3rd 15:33, UML (4-3) | Chase Blackmun nudged the puck to Andre Lee in the high slot and his wrister found the left corner blocker side.
Â
3rd 16:39, UML (4-4) | Lucas Condotta drifted below the left faceoff dot on the power play and snuck a shot past Knight's blocker short side.
Â
3rd 17:53, BC (5-4) | Boldy reeled in a cross-ice pass from Newhook on the right wing and centered to McLaughlin, who controlled the puck away from a Lowell defenseman and beat Welsch low glove side.
Â
3rd 18:34, UML (5-5) | Baxter received a pass at the left point and fired a shot on target that took a deflection in the slot and found the bottom right corner.
Â
2OT 12:00, UML (5-6) | From the end boards, Seth Barton flipped a backhand to the front of the net and Brown whacked the puck out of mid-air to the far post for the winner.
Â
UP NEXT
Boston College will find out its opponent and destination for the NCAA Tournament on Sunday (March 21) during the NCAA Selection Show, which airs at 7 p.m. on ESPNU.
